You're right, of course. And I realize that I can't always compare myself to other people because I don't know their height or other contributing factors.

One thing I've noticed in watching TV shows about weight loss -- some people were eating 3000 to 5000 calories per day before starting their pre-op and having surgery. I've lived ON AVERAGE in the 1600 - 2000 range for the better part of two decades! Sure, I had an occasional 4K day, but I had many, MANY more 1000-1200 days while trying to diet!!

The band has kept me CONSISTENTLY in the 1200-1400 range so it's a reduction, but not so huge that great gobs of weight is falling off.
